eBay: During last few years, eBay has also transformed itself and working on its selling activities. It has worked on its platform and has more than 155 million buyers. The eBay store has a listing and managing inventory and provides an easily operational user interface. Even the online marketplace helps the sellers to display their products for the customers who are based in the foreign countries. The strength of the eBay marketplace is that t provides it sellers with an International E-commerce platform and reaches out to the global users.

Shopify: Most of the sellers refer Shopify as it provides a solution for managing the inventory, the products, reporting directly on the platform and fulfillment by the sellers. Even the sellers can publish their Shopify products on the other multichannel like Etsy, Amazon, eBay, etc. The seller can synchronize the inventory between the Shopify accounts and other product selling marketplaces. Another advantage of using the Shopify is the display of infinite products, whether it is in thousands or hundreds.
